totem-plugin-arte version 0.9.2-1 failed to build on i386

Bug #756186 reported by Matthias Klose
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
totem-plugin-arte (Ubuntu)
Fix Released
High
Nicolas Delvaux

Bug Description

totem-plugin-arte version 0.9.2-1 failed to build on i386
Link to failed build: https://launchpad.net/ubuntu/+archive/test-rebuild-20110329/+buildjob/2412068

Direct link to the build log: https://launchpad.net/ubuntu/+archive/test-rebuild-20110329/+buildjob/2412068/+files/buildlog_ubuntu-natty-i386.totem-plugin-arte_0.9.2-1_FAILEDTOBUILD.txt.gz

This log snippet might be of interest, since it triggered the matcher 'Purging chroot-autobuild'.
Excerpt 1444 lines into the build log:

  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
url-extractor.vala:54.3-54.43: error: error type `ExtractionError` is less accessible than method `StreamUrlExtractor.extract_string_from_page`
  protected string extract_string_from_page (string url, string regexp)
  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
url-extractor.vala:81.3-81.23: error: error type `ExtractionError` is less accessible than method `RTMPStreamUrlExtractor.get_url`
  public string get_url (VideoQuality q, Language lang, string page_url)
  ^^^^^^^^^^^^^^^^^^^^^
url-extractor.vala:173.3-173.23: error: error type `ExtractionError` is less accessible than method `MP4StreamUrlExtractor.get_url`
  public string get_url (VideoQuality q, Language lang, string page_url)
  ^^^^^^^^^^^^^^^^^^^^^
Compilation failed: 14 error(s), 3 warning(s)
make[1]: *** [all] Error 1
make[1]: Leaving directory `/build/buildd/totem-plugin-arte-0.9.2'
make: *** [build-stamp] Error 2
dpkg-buildpackage: error: debian/rules build gave error exit status 2
******************************************************************************
Build finished at 20110408-1808
FAILED [dpkg-buildpackage died]
Purging chroot-autobuild/build/buildd/totem-plugin-arte-0.9.2

Tags: ftbfs natty

Related branches

Matthias Klose (doko)
Changed in totem-plugin-arte (Ubuntu):
importance: Undecided → High
Revision history for this message
Nicolas Delvaux (malizor) wrote :

Thanks for this bug report.

It can't build because Natty switched to vala-0.12 by default (this package should depends on vala-0.10).
I'll take care of this.

Revision history for this message
Nicolas Delvaux (malizor) wrote :

A fixed package was uploaded to Debian (patch to build against vala-0.12).
I'll ask for a sync later.

Changed in totem-plugin-arte (Ubuntu):
status: New → In Progress
assignee: nobody → Nicolas Delvaux (malaria)
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package totem-plugin-arte - 0.9.2-3

---------------
totem-plugin-arte (0.9.2-3) unstable; urgency=low

  * Build-Depends on valac-0.12 (LP: #756186)
    - Cherry pick relevant patchs from upstream

totem-plugin-arte (0.9.2-2) unstable; urgency=low

  * Upload to unstable
  * debian/control:
    - Build-Depends on valac-0.10 instead of valac
    - Add Homepage
  * debian/patches: backport some code from upstream git
    - Search entry: Really set focus to the first video on return
    - Deal with video access restriction
    - New context menu: add a "right click" -> "Open in Web Browser" option
    - Update translations
    - Update user agent (not from upstream)
    - Build without debug messages by default (not from upstream)
 -- Nicolas Delvaux <email address hidden> Fri, 15 Apr 2011 14:23:51 +0000

Changed in totem-plugin-arte (Ubuntu):
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.